What You’ll Do
  • Supporting our clients in all aspects of their daily life, i.e. meal preparation, medication prompts and general domestic support
  • Assisting clients with personal care
  • Providing companionship and accompanying clients on outings
  • Encouraging clients to take an active role in the planning and provision of their care
  • Recording and reporting daily visit information accurately
